Portland Opera Announces 23-24 Resident Artists
by A.A. Cristi
- Jul 27, 2023
Portland Opera has announced the artists selected to join the company's Resident Artist program for the 2023/24 season: returning soprano Judy Yannini, tenor Antonio Domino, tenor Roland Hawkins II, baritone Sankara Harouna, and collaborative pianist Edward Forstman. Portland Opera's Resident Artist (PORA) program, established in 2005, is one of the company's core programs—a rigorous residency and training program centered on the cultivation and support of emerging artists, as a bridge between the academic and professional world of opera.
